What Is Quick Turn PCB Assembly?
Quick turn PCB assembly is a fast-turn manufacturing service designed to assemble printed circuit boards on an accelerated timeline—typically for prototypes, engineering builds, and early-stage production. The goal is to compress lead time while keeping assembly quality consistent, ensuring you can test, validate, and iterate quickly.
Quick turn PCBA commonly includes:
- DFM review and assembly feasibility checks
- BOM validation and component readiness confirmation
- SMT placement, reflow, and/or through-hole soldering
- Inspection and electrical testing as required
- Optional functional testing and programming
Quick turn does not mean “rush at all costs.” At FastTurn, quick turn assembly is executed through streamlined workflows, disciplined process control, and integrated quality checkpoints to keep speed and reliability aligned.

- DFM Review & Process Control
Every quick turn project begins with checks for:
- BOM accuracy and substitutions (when needed)
- Footprint and polarity risks
- Stencil and paste strategy alignment
- Reflow profile considerations and thermal sensitivity
- Through-hole spacing/solderability constraints (if applicable)

Testing & Validation Capabilities (as required)
- Electrical Testing (Flying Probe / Fixture-Based)
Verifies connectivity and detects opens/shorts for both prototype and production builds.
- Impedance Support (TDR Guidance / Verification as Required)
Aligns fabrication controls with impedance targets and helps validate critical structures when specified.
- Microsection (Optional)
Confirms layer structure, plating integrity, and construction compliance for RF stackups.
- Reliability Screening (Optional / Program-Based)
Stress screening approaches can be applied when the end-use environment requires additional confidence.
- Documentation Support
Inspection records and build traceability aligned with project requirements.
